Fo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the stability of a building’s foundation when it shows signs of damage or shifting. This process typically includes identifying the root causes of foundation issues, such as soil movement or water damage, and then implementing solutions like piering, underpinning, or slab stabilization. These repairs are designed to strengthen the foundation, prevent further settling, and help maintain the overall safety and integrity of the property. Homeowners interested in foundation repair should seek experienced local contractors who specialize in these techniques to ensure the work is done correctly and effectively.
Common problems that foundation repair services address include cracking walls,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ible gaps around the foundation or basement walls. These issues often develop gradually but can lead to significant structural concerns if left unaddressed. Foundation problems may be caused by a variety of factors, such as soil expansion and contraction, poor drainage, or nearby excavation activities. Recognizing early signs of foundation trouble and consulting with local experts can help pr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kaufman County,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or foundation repairs such as crack sealing or small underpinning projects range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, though costs can vary based on the extent of damage and local rates.
Moderate Repairs - Larger issues like partial foundation stabilization or repair work us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for homes experiencing noticeable settling or minor shifts, with costs increasing for more extensive work.
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ement or major underpinning projects can range from $10,000 to $30,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ity. Such large-scale jobs are less frequent but are necessary for severe structural problems.
Complex or Custom Projects - Very large or intricate foundation repairs, including extensive underpinning or custom solutions, can exceed $50,000. These projects are less common and usually involve specialized techniques handled by experienced local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ing foundation repair service providers in Kaufman County,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to the one at hand.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a history of successfully handling foundation issues in homes comparable in size, age, and construction style. An experienced service provider will understand the common challenges faced in the area and be better equipped to recommend effective solutions, reducing the risk of unforeseen complications.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the steps involved in the repair process. Having this information in writing helps ensure everyone is aligned on what will be done, avoiding misunderstandings and providing a basis for comparing different options objectively.
Reputable references and effective communication are also key factors in selecting a foundation repair contractor. Local service providers with a solid reputation will be able to provide references from previous clients who can share their experiences. Good communication throughout the process-prompt responses, transparency about procedures, and openness to questions-can make the experience smoother and more predictable. It’s worth taking the time to verify references and observe how well a contractor communicates to find a reliable partner for the project.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around door frames or moldings.
How can foundation issues affect a home? Foundation problems can lead to structural damage, reduced stability, and increased repair costs if not addressed promptly.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Local contractors may offer foundation leveling, pier and beam repairs, crack injections, and underpinning to stabilize and restore the foundation.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air, but a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ed to prevent further damage.
